Unlocking the Lowest Fares on Vienna-Budapest Flixbus Bookings

Booking 3-6 weeks in advance yields the lowest prices on this route. Avoid peak travel seasons like summer weekends and holidays when fares surge. The Flixbus calendar view is your most powerful tool—it clearly identifies the cheapest travel days, with mid-week departures typically costing significantly less than weekend options.

New app users receive €5-€10 discount codes on initial bookings through first-time user promotions. This alone can reduce your ticket to nearly free territory. Flixbus regularly emails exclusive flash deals and limited-time promotions to newsletter subscribers, so joining their mailing list pays dividends.

Earlier buses departing at 6-7 AM typically cost less than afternoon or evening options. Monitor the same route over 2-3 weeks to understand pricing patterns and identify optimal booking windows. Sometimes booking separate one-way tickets offers better value than roundtrip packages for this corridor.

Verify eligibility for special rates through verified student programs and youth discount initiatives. These can reduce fares by an additional 10-15%. Every tactic stacks—combine early booking with a student discount code and an early morning departure, and you've just maximized savings across multiple variables.

Maximizing Comfort on a 3-4 Hour Journey

Choose window seats for better sleep quality; aisle seats offer easier restroom access during the journey. If you're tall, request seats in the front section to avoid cramped middle rows with limited legroom. Bring neck pillows, blankets, and eye masks to make extended seating significantly more comfortable.

Pack water bottles and snacks since onboard food isn't guaranteed on this intercity bus route. Identify which seats have functional USB ports and power outlets before departure for device charging. Wear layers to adapt to varying bus temperatures throughout your journey—climate control can be unpredictable.

Invest in quality earplugs or noise-canceling headphones to manage engine and traffic noise effectively. Use facilities before boarding since onboard restrooms are limited; plan bathroom timing strategically around scheduled stops. The difference between comfort and discomfort on a 3-4 hour journey often comes down to these preparation details.

Free Wi-Fi is available but may be inconsistent for streaming or video calls during travel. Pre-download movies, podcasts, or ebooks before boarding for entertainment backup when connectivity fails. Consider using your phone's hotspot if you have sufficient data as an alternative to unreliable bus Wi-Fi.

Stick to lightweight browsing, email, and messaging rather than bandwidth-heavy tasks on the bus. Wi-Fi tends to be stronger during the first hour and final hour of the journey through Austria and Hungary. Use offline maps, language translators, and travel guides that don't require internet connectivity.

Send messages before boarding and expect delayed responses during travel on this intercity route. Enable data saver mode on your device to maximize connectivity when Wi-Fi is available onboard. Managing Common Travel Challenges on This Route

The Vienna-Budapest route occasionally experiences delays due to border crossings and traffic congestion issues. Understand your rights regarding compensation for significant delays, typically 30 minutes or longer. Use the Flixbus app to monitor your bus's location and receive real-time delay notifications during travel.

Build buffer time if you're connecting to other transportation in Budapest to avoid missed connections. Pack strategically since overhead storage is limited; prioritize essentials for this 3-4 hour journey. The route includes scheduled stops; know where and when they occur for bathroom and stretch breaks.

Occasionally Flixbus substitutes buses for maintenance; your ticket remains valid on replacement vehicles. Winter conditions may cause minor delays; plan accordingly during cold months in Central Europe. Anticipating these challenges prevents stress and keeps your itinerary flexible.
